Job Title: Backend Engineer

Location: Lagos

Employment Type: Full-time

Job Summary

  • Our client is looking for a talented Full Stack Engineer to join their innovative team.
  • The ideal candidate must have a strong background in both front-end and back-end development, specifically with Next.js and Nest.js.

Responsibilities

  • Write, test, and maintain high-quality code and documentation.
  • Build prototypes and resolve technical issues while profiling and analyzing performance bottlenecks.
  • Design robust APIs to support mobile and desktop clients.
  • Manage and optimize scalable distributed systems in the cloud.
  • Optimize web applications for performance and scalability.
  • Develop automated tests to ensure business requirements are met and facilitate regression testing.
  • Collaborate with the development team to build and enhance back-office tools.
  • Contribute to architecture discussions and decisions to enhance application design and functionality.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field (preferred but not required).
  • 4+ years of experience in software development with a proven track record of delivering successful projects.
  • Expertise in programming languages such as JavaScript and TypeScript (preference for TypeScript).
  • Strong understanding of web technologies (HTML, CSS, JavaScript, TypeScript) and frameworks (Next.js, Nest.js, React).
  • Experience with cloud platforms such as AWS or Huawei Cloud, as well as containerization technologies like Docker and Kubernetes.
  • Solid understanding of software architecture, design patterns, and data structures.
  • Proven experience with RESTful APIs, microservices architecture, and distributed systems.
  • Familiarity with CI/CD pipelines and DevOps practices.
  • Knowledge of fintech regulations, payment processing systems, and security standards.
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ills, along with strong problem-solving abilities.
